All models are equipped with power steering. The steering mechanism is bolted to the subframe and controls the levers through the steering rods. The inner ends of the tie rods are protected by rubber boots that are subject to periodic checks for reliability of connection, breaks, and leakage of lubricant.

The power steering consists of a pump with a drive belt and related pipelines and hoses. It is necessary to periodically check the fluid level in the reservoir of the power steering pump (Chapter 1).

The steering wheel rotates the steering shaft connected to the steering mechanism through the universal joints and the intermediate shaft.

Steering wheel play can be caused by wear on the steering shaft universal joints, the gear rack of the inner and outer tie rod joints, and loose lock bolts.
